​EA Sports FC 25: Best Formations and Tactics for Ultimate Team Meta

In the ever-evolving landscape of EA Sports FC 25 Ultimate Team, mastering the right formations and tactics is crucial to gaining a competitive edge. Whether you're aiming for Division Rivals glory or Weekend League dominance, understanding the current meta can significantly enhance your gameplay. This guide explores the best formations and tactical setups dominating the FC 25 meta right now.

5-2-1-2: The Defensive Powerhouse

The 5-2-1-2 formation has emerged as a top-tier defensive setup in FC 25. With three central defenders and two wingbacks, this system locks down wide threats while enabling sharp counterattacks.

Custom Tactics:

  • Build-Up Play: Balanced

  • Chance Creation: Direct Passing

  • Defensive Style: Balanced

  • Width: 50

  • Depth: 60

Player Instructions:

  • Wingbacks: Join the Attack, Overlap

  • CM1: Stay Back While Attacking, Cover Center

  • CM2: Balanced

  • CAM: Free Roam

  • Strikers: Stay Central, Get In Behind

This formation excels in matches where your opponent relies heavily on wing play or speedy wingers.

4-1-2-1-2 (Narrow): The Midfield Maestro

If your playstyle is about controlling the center of the pitch, this narrow variation is for you. Perfect for quick passing and aggressive midfield play, this formation overwhelms opponents who leave gaps down the middle.

Custom Tactics:

  • Build-Up Play: Fast Build Up

  • Chance Creation: Forward Runs

  • Defensive Style: Balanced

  • Width: 40

  • Depth: 55

Player Instructions:

  • CDM: Stay Back While Attacking, Cover Center

  • CMs: Get Forward, Get Into The Box

  • CAM: Stay Forward, Free Roam

  • STs: Stay Central, Get In Behind

This setup allows for quick 1-2s, lethal through balls, and smooth central penetrations.

4-2-3-1: The Balanced Approach

A fan-favorite for consistency, the 4-2-3-1 formation blends defense and attack seamlessly. It allows for great build-up play and keeps your shape when defending transitions.

Custom Tactics:

  • Build-Up Play: Balanced

  • Chance Creation: Possession

  • Defensive Style: Balanced

  • Width: 50

  • Depth: 50

Player Instructions:

  • CDMs: Stay Back While Attacking, Cover Center

  • LM/RM: Cut Inside, Get In Behind

  • CAM: Free Roam

  • ST: Stay Central, Target Man

It’s a go-to choice for players who like to control the tempo of the match.

4-3-2-1: The Attacking Trident

The 4-3-2-1 thrives in high-pressure, fast-paced gameplay. With three narrow forwards, you can overload central areas and catch opponents off guard with quick vertical passing.

Custom Tactics:

  • Build-Up Play: Long Ball

  • Chance Creation: Forward Runs

  • Defensive Style: Press After Possession Loss

  • Width: 40

  • Depth: 70

Player Instructions:

  • CM1: Stay Back While Attacking

  • CM2: Get Forward

  • LF/RF: Cut Inside, Get In Behind

  • ST: Stay Central, Get In Behind

Ideal for players who favor constant attacking pressure and tight gameplay.

4-4-2: The Classic Formation

Back to basics, the 4-4-2 still reigns as one of the most well-rounded formations in FC 25. It’s ideal for players who want both stability and effective offensive options.

Custom Tactics:

  • Build-Up Play: Balanced

  • Chance Creation: Direct Passing

  • Defensive Style: Balanced

  • Width: 50

  • Depth: 60

Player Instructions:

  • CMs: One Stay Back While Attacking, one Balanced

  • LM/RM: Cut Inside, Get In Behind

  • STs: Stay Central, Get In Behind

The 4-4-2 provides great width and offers enough midfield support for defense and offense.

💡 Tips to Master Your Formations

1. Pick Players Based on Roles

Don’t just focus on high-rated players. Choose players with attributes suited to your tactics—for instance, agile wingbacks for 5-2-1-2 or strong CDMs for 4-2-3-1.

2. Practice Your Patterns

Play friendlies or training matches to build muscle memory around your chosen formation. Understand player movements, overlaps, and defensive shapes.

3. Adapt During Games

Don't be afraid to switch tactics mid-match using D-Pad adjustments or pause menu strategies. Being flexible is crucial for top-tier players.

4. Follow the Meta

Check FUT community insights, pro player lineups, and update patch notes to stay on top of meta changes that might affect your preferred setup.

Final Thoughts

Whether you're grinding Weekend League or climbing the Division Rivals ladder, understanding the best EA Sports FC 25 formations and tactics will elevate your game. This year's meta strongly favors formations like 5-2-1-2, 4-3-2-1, and 4-1-2-1-2, but the best setup is one that complements your playstyle.
